Speaking of Owen Wilson, a few people have asked me what the title of my web log is all about. Mr. Henry is a character played by James Caan in the movie Bottle Rocket starring Owen and Luke Wilson, and written by Owen and Wes Anderson. If you haven't seen the movie, it's a classic - well at least the first 45 minutes and the last 1/2 hour. Feel free to fast forward throught the entire motel part.
